Brown-Forman Regional Marketing Operations Manager POS & Gift - USA&C/Global (REMOTE) in Chicago, Illinois
"As a leader within Global Marketing Operations, this role partners closely with our global sourcing agency and regional marketing operation managers throughout the world. This role ensures we have all the right systems, processes and procedures in place to successfully manage our point of sale (POS) promotions and activations. Working closely with our USA&C sales and marketing organization and Global brand teams, this role will champion our new agency partnership ensuring everything runs smooth. Your daily efforts will vary from facilitating regional buys to monitoring our online store where our POS items should be readily available for purchase to partnering with our finance colleagues to properly track and expense to working with our agency partner to escalate and quickly solve issues as they arise. This is an exciting opportunity for a detail oriented, operations focused leader who enjoys collaborating with a high number of stakeholders bringing our promotions to life!" -- Cindy Seiler Reichert, Director, Global Marketing Operations & Account Management
Meaningful Work From Day One:
● Provides management and leadership of the region’s Global POS & Gift sourcing partnership.
● Responsible for activities associated with all operations and distribution of all Brown Forman shipments to and from HH Global hub warehouse, as well as coordinating with Brown-Forman owned distribution local warehouses.
● Primary contact for HH Global for the region, leading our quarterly business review (QBR) sessions, acts as an escalation point and resolution for any issues or concerns, and manages our overall regional partnership. Provides input and participates in contract negotiations, as needed.
● Collaborates with other regional leads to provide input and feedback on our global contract and performance with HH Global. Responsible for developing/managing the local statements of work in their region ensuring both parties are partnering appropriately and meeting the terms of the agreements.
● Drives collaborative efforts across the region to ensure we are leveraging the expertise and buying power that HHG will provide, as well as ensuring we are appropriately creating/purchasing the correct ratio of globally, regionally, and locally-created POS and Gift.
● Champions our partnership with HH Global encouraging the region to follow the defined ways of working and addressing concerns when the process is not followed.
● Leads, develops, manages, and promotes our processes and procedures to ensure we are operating efficiently (and in alignment with all procurement policies - eg. procurement, human rights, supplier code of conduct, etc.) across the region.
● Process expert for sourcing global, regional, & local POS and Gift.
● Aligns and coordinates regional buy calendars and contributes to the coordination of global buy schedules.
● Strong, proactive communicator … clearly shares expectations with local markets, holds the market accountable for … (allocations, new requests, etc). This includes influencing and gaining support for key processes and initiatives.
● Manages an annual review process of inventory in Q2, working with HH Global and marketing to identify any discontinued items not selling to limit obsolescence and identify plans to deplete inventory.
● Ensure VALO system is configured and maintained, providing system enhancement input, training or assisting users with the system, and ensuring our reporting needs are met.
● Partners with regional leadership and divisional market manager to evaluate how the market is applying the BF Way of Brand Building as it applies to Gift & POS. Sharing reports and providing recommendations where adjustments may be needed.
● Establishes relationships and nurtures partnerships with GBS and/or Supply Chain Procurement to monitor and share category management strategies, results and guidance.
● Responsible for understanding all related procurement policies and sharing with the region as needed.
● Monitors region’s level of satisfaction with HHG partnership seeking feedback on a regular basis.
● Ensures systems are set up and maintained for proper financial reporting, invoicing processing, account reconciling (intercompany and internal cost distributions) , intercompany transactions, and efficient payment processing.
● Accountable for business unit P&L performance
● Approves regional and local Gift requests in partnership with divisional marketing and regional leadership.
What Exactly Are We Looking For?
Bachelors’ Degree or equivalent in business or related discipline.
Minimum 5 to 7 years experience in marketing or sourcing.
Experience managing sourcing agency and vendor relationships.
Process workflow expert with proven process improvement leadership and system management experience.
Demonstrated experience leading change and influencing decisions/outcomes.
Strong solution oriented communicator and collaborator. Experience in building strong relationships with multiple areas (Outside Agencies/Partners, Marketing, Commercial, GBS, Supply Chain, Finance, Other) and regions.
Strong problem solving and analytical skills.
Demonstrated ability to manage multiple projects and initiatives.
Strong business acumen and budget development and management.
Proven ability to engage, empower and develop talent through inclusive leadership. Active DEI champion.
What Makes You Unique:
Experience working with consumer durables, consumer products, and/or specific beverage industry experience.
Knowledge of the Brown-Forman organization and its business.
Experience leading projects with international organizations with diverse cultures, business operations, and organizational needs.
